About Alberta
Visitors to Alberta are often struck by the wide-open space—the mountains, pristine lakes and sweeping prairie. That space, perhaps, shapes how we live—with plenty of room to reach for our dreams. Albertans enjoy a stable economy, no provincial sales tax, a world-class education system and excellent public health care. The air and water are clean, parks and green spaces are abundant; in addition to plenty of sports and recreation opportunities, there are many arts and culture activities to enjoy.
Visitors will find that the awareness of space is accompanied by an awareness of community. Albertans have built their communities with institutions and organizations often uniquely Albertan, often through volunteer commitment. Communities are valued by the provincial government, which provides a considerable standard of service for communities throughout the province.
